Jerky on acceleration
Hi guys, recently had the ecu go on my classic, replaced it but it seems to have lost power, it does have a unichip piggyback on it. Anyway when i put my foot down it accelerates slower and in every gear it loses all power just for a split second and then is back on. When i hit boost its fine and doesnt do it but it doesnt feel like its hitting as much boost as it should even tho my gauge is saying it is. It has even kangaroo hopped a couple of times when ive accelerated. Do i need to get it remapped again since i replaced the ecu or has anyone got any suggestions that i can try?

does your engine check light work? i would connect the test wires and see if its stored any faults, i had the same problem, it flashed out as being the knock sensor, i removed and cleaned it and reset the ECU and as yet its fine, drives smooth with full power again.
